The Koki Restaurant UD TOWN
The Koki Restaurant, located within the UD Town precinct on Thongyai Road, is a popular dining destination in Udon Thani that draws a consistent crowd thanks to its accessible pricing and reliable quality. Sitting in one of the city's busiest commercial zones, it benefits from a convenient location that makes it easy to combine with shopping or other errands in the area. Guests can expect a mid-range dining experience with a welcoming atmosphere suited to casual meals, family outings, and relaxed gatherings. The restaurant's strong and sustained rating points to consistent food quality and attentive service, making it a dependable choice for both residents and visitors passing through Udon Thani. The restaurant operates seven days a week from 10:30 to 22:00, giving visitors flexibility whether they are looking for a midday meal or a relaxed dinner. Arriving during off-peak hours — mid-afternoon or early evening — is a practical way to avoid the busier lunchtime and weekend dinner rushes that a well-rated spot in a commercial hub tends to attract. No website is currently listed, so it is advisable to call ahead or visit in person to check for any menu or availability updates.

Getting there
Udon Thani Airport (UTH) has frequent Bangkok flights (~65 min). The overnight sleeper train from Bangkok to Nong Khai stops here (~9 hrs); buses from Mo Chit take 7–8 hours. Vientiane (Laos) is 80 km via the Friendship Bridge.
Getting around
- •Songthaews on numbered city routes (฿10–15)
- •Grab and metered taxis in the city
- •Minivans and trains to Nong Khai (55 km, ~1 hr)
- •Rental car for the Red Lotus Sea and Ban Chiang (both ~50 km out)

Tips for Visiting Restaurants & Food
Learn the Spice Scale
Say 'mai pet' for no spice, 'pet nit noi' for a little spice, or 'pet mak' if you want it Thai-hot. Most cooks will default to a toned-down version for foreigners unless you specify otherwise.
Follow the Crowds
The busiest street stalls are almost always the best — high turnover means fresh ingredients and a recipe that locals vouch for. An empty restaurant at dinner time is a red flag.
Ice Is Safe
Factory-made tube or cylinder ice (used in virtually all restaurants and stalls) is made from purified water and is safe to consume. You don't need to skip the iced Thai tea.
